Context is key when interpreting the meaning behind a verse of the Bible. Many Christians might believe that Jeremiah 29:11 must mean that God will give His people prosperous lives without suffering. However, when we explore the background of the book of Jeremiah leading up to the verse, we discover that it has a much richer message than that.
